"This whiskey bar’s lineup of Old Fashioneds strikes a balance between elegance and flair. The Smoked Old Fashioned ($16) combines Elijah Craig bourbon, turbinado sugar, and Angostura bitters, with a finisher of aromatic cherrywood smoke. For a side of drama, try the Flaming Old Fashioned ($16), where a float of overproof rum is set ablaze. The Permission Old Fashioned with Maker’s 46 ($13), the Tequila Old Fashioned made with Herradura Reposado and mezcal ($12), and the Barrel-Aged Old Fashioned featuring Heaven’s Door bourbon ($16) complete the offerings." - Brianna Griff

"This local watering hole features an entire lineup of holiday cocktails, with fun spins on classics, including a salted caramel carajillo, a Cookies and Cream Espresso Martini, and a standout peanut butter Old Fashioned. This nutty rendition of this iconic cocktail mixes house-infused peanut butter bourbon, Angostura and orange bitters, and turbinado sugar for nostalgia in a glass." - Marcy de Luna


"This upscale Heights cocktail bar is known for its dark spirits but it’s got a menu of impressive cocktails, too, including a top-notch espresso martini. In Permission’s iteration, the drink is made with Reyka vodka, espresso, Mr. Black coffee liqueur, and Bailey’s." - Brittany Britto Garley
